8 I have the same problems (with a dv8000 laptop) I applied the patch to
9 alsa-1.0.13 (after a few modifications) and the quality of the sound
10 improved significantly. I also get more switches in alsamixer. However,
11 the microphone still doesn't work. I have a column saying ExtMic in
12 alsamixer, but it says only 'L CAPTUR R' in red, and has no volume
13 control. Is there a way to make the microphone work as well?
